Hexagonal Architecture really isn’t about hexagons. It may not even be architecture.
Hexagonal Architecture is a design philosophy based upon boundary constraints.
These constraints are a catalyst that unifies common practices and procedures, such as Design Patterns, Domain-Driven Design, Test-Driven Design, and more within a common context.
